Repair the UMD Drive on a PSP
Repair the UMD Drive on a PSP

Before you get rid of your PSP because it will no longer play UMDs, try this simple fix. Often times the settings of your PSP need to be changed and a hard reset of the PSP is needed. These steps will tell you how to easily make the repair yourself.

Difficulty: Easy
Instructions

Things You'll Need:

  • small screwdriver
  • 5 minutes
  1. Step 1

    The first step is to change your UMD Auto Start Settings.
    Select Settings, System Settings, UMD Auto Start, and ON.

  2. Step 2

    Once your settings have been changed, it's time to give your PSP a hard reset. Now remove your PSP battery. Push down on the battery cover, slide cover off, place finger on the battery at the top and pull back to remove. If you have trouble, use your small screwdriver to gently pop the battery out.

  3. Step 3

    Once the battery is out, put any UMD in the PSP. Make sure it is a working UMD!

  4. Step 4

    After you have the UMD In your PSP, replace your battery and cover, now your PSP should work!

  • DO NOT PRY the battery out - this could cause damage.
